This homemade Breakfast Sausage is made with ground pork and seasonings, like herbs, garlic, and paprika. You can make it ahead of time and freeze it to always have it on hand!
½ teaspoon salt, ½ teaspoon black pepper, 1 teaspoon minced garlic, ¼ teaspoon rosemary, ¼ teaspoon thyme, ¼ teaspoon sage, ½ teaspoon paprika
Mix it thoroughly. Use your hands for best results.
You can chill the mixture for up to 12 hours or use right away.
Using an spring scoop or ¼ cup, scoop mixture and form into ½" thick patties OR scoop 2 tablespoons of pork mixture and form into links.
Heat up a tablespoon of vegetable or olive oil in a pan and fry sausage on both sides until nicely brown and cooked through.
Serve right away or cool completely and freeze.
Notes
If you are using lean ground pork (80% lean), there might be not enough fat in it to make the sausage juicy. Add 3 to 4 slices of bacon, chopped to the sausage mixture before forming into patties.
Prep the mixture as stated in the recipe, form into patties, and freeze on freezer paper-lined baking sheet, then place in a freezer bag OR fry in pan, cool completely, then freeze. Thaw it in the fridge and cook in a pan before serving.
